2016-06-22 2 views
0

:HTML 5 비디오 페이지로드에 완전히 버퍼링하지 내가 추적하여 페이지로드 HTML 5 비디오 버퍼하려고

<video width="320" height="240" id="myVid" controls="controls" preload="auto"> 
    <source src="http://clips.vorwaerts-gmbh.de/VfE_html5.mp4" type="video/mp4"> 
    <object data="" width="320" height="240"></object> 
</video> 

을하지만, 비디오 재생 및 박히없이 페이지로드 버퍼만을 40-50%를 가져옵니다 . 페이지로드시 전체 비디오를 버퍼링 한 다음 재생하려고합니다.

링크 : http://codepen.io/anon/pen/XKNeYQ

+0

가능한 다른 복제본 : [Chrome에서 강제로 mp4 비디오를 완전히 버퍼링] (http://stackoverflow.com/questions/18251632/another-force-chrome-to-fully-buffer-mp4-video) – Turnip

+0

[ 'canplaythrough'] (https://developer.mozilla.org/en-US/docs/Web/Events/canplaythrough) 이벤트 – Rayon

+0

preload = "auto"를 시도했는데 내 요구 사항을 완전히 채우지 않았습니다. 나는 이것을 위해 canplaythrough를 사용하는 방법을 모른다. –

답변

0

자체가 미리로드 얼마나 많은 결정 브라우저. 너는 그것을 바꿀 수 없다. 자세한 내용은 표 here을보십시오. 일부 브라우저에는 제한 시간이 있습니다. 유일한 다른 옵션은 사용자의 요구를 지원하는 맞춤 비디오 플레이어를 사용하는 것입니다.

관련 문제